Rail Regulator launches new ‘code’ for disabled passengers
Tom Winsor, the Rail Regulator, today began consulting on a new code of practice which will set standards of service and access for disabled passengers, and provide an achievable framework in which to deliver consistent standards. The first code of practice was published in July 1994, and the Rail Regulator has a duty under section 70 of the Railways Act 1993 to revise the code taking into account the legal requirements now imposed by the Disability Discrimination Act 1995.
Commenting on the draft code - Train and Station Services for Disabled Passengers - Tom Winsor said: "I am committed to ensuring that the railway industry makes real progress in improving the accessibility of its services for people with disabilities. Of all public transport, the railways have the greatest potential for improving the quality of life for people who are disabled, and I want to create a code that provides a framework for progress towards a more accessible railway system."
Following an eight-week period for consultation, the Rail Regulator will review contributions generated by the consultation process and incorporate these, where appropriate, into the revised code of practice which will be published later this year.
